# PHP Fatal Error: Cannot declare class Ctct\CTCTSplClassLoader

 *  Resolved [Wendell](https://wordpress.org/support/users/wendellh/)
 * (@wendellh)
 * [9 years, 2 months ago](https://wordpress.org/support/topic/php-fatal-error-cannot-declare-class-ctctctctsplclassloader/)
 * PHP Fatal error: Cannot declare class Ctct\CTCTSplClassLoader, because the name
   is already in use in /home/username/public_html/wp-content/plugins/constant-contact-
   forms/vendor/constantcontact/constantcontact/constantcontact/src/Ctct/SplClassLoader.
   php on line 22
 * This is causing a 500 error when we attempt to access wp-admin, so we are unable
   to access the WP Dashboard.

 * What other Constant Contact plugin/integration are you using, if you know?
 * In version 1.2.2, we made a change to a couple things, renaming a bundled class
   of “SplClassLoader” to “CTCTSplClassLoader” but from the looks of what you have,
   that’s causing a different name collision. Would love the chance to check out
   the code from that plugin, especially if it’s one available on wordpress.org.

 * I suspected that it might be a conflict with MailMunch — so I deactivated MailMunch
   by renaming the plugin folder. That didn’t change anything. When I rename the
   Constant Contact plugin by renaming the folder, everything works great.

 * Something in the install is also loading a copy of the Constant Contact SDK, 
   just a matter of tracking down what.

 * It seems to be a lovely plugin called Hustle from the folks at WPMU Dev. [https://premium.wpmudev.org/project/hustle/](https://premium.wpmudev.org/project/hustle/)
 * I deactivated that plugin and the CC plugin seems to be working just fine.
